Coeur d'Alene Parkinson's
Support Group Meeting
***All of our events and classes are free and open to the public.***
This group is for men and women with Parkinson's, their family and caregivers, or anyone interested in Parkinson's. We meet on the first Thursday of every month, from 1:00 - 2:30 p.m. We meet in a casual setting to share information and our experiences and methods of coping with Parkinson’s disease. We often have a speaker from the medical community. Lunch or a snack will be served. It is held at the Elks Lodge, 1170 West Prairie Avenue, Coeur d'Alene.

Music and Wellness
This is a great class for strengthening your voice and improving the clarity of your speech. It is a lot of fun and it is taught by our certified Music Therapist, Carla Carnegie. No singing ability required. Just come and have fun with the rhythm instruments and the voice exercises that really do increase the volume of your voice. It meets on the 2nd, 3rd and 4th Thursdays of each month from 11:30 am. to 12:15p.m. It is held at the Elks Lodge, 1170 West Prairie Avenue, Coeur d'Alene.
